The cheapest way to get from Nottingham to Arley Hall is to drive which costs £18 - £27 and takes 1h 50m.
The fastest way to get from Nottingham to Arley Hall is to drive which takes 1h 50m and costs £18 - £27.
The distance between Nottingham and Arley Hall is 107 miles. The road distance is 75.1 miles.
The best way to get from Nottingham to Arley Hall without a car is to train which takes 2h 26m and costs £40 - £75.
It takes approximately 2h 26m to get from Nottingham to Arley Hall, including transfers.
The best way to get from Nottingham to Arley Hall is to train which takes 2h 26m and costs £40 - £75. Alternatively, you can bus, which costs and takes 3h 46m.
Yes, the driving distance between Nottingham to Arley Hall is 75 miles. It takes approximately 1h 50m to drive from Nottingham to Arley Hall.

What companies run services between Nottingham, England and Arley Hall, England?
East Midlands Railways operates a train from Nottingham to Warrington Central hourly. Tickets cost £22–50 and the journey takes 2h 12m. Alternatively, Atlantic Travel GB Ltd operates a bus from Greyfriar Gate to Shudehill Interchange hourly, and the journey takes 2h 50m.
